Shadow Veja 7 is a light, normal width, medium contrast, italic, short x-height font.

A lively, slanted display face with brush-pen construction and noticeable tapering at terminals. Strokes alternate between fuller curves and sharp, knife-like angles, producing a rhythmic, hand-drawn texture. Many glyphs show an internal cut or separated fill that reads as a subtle inner void and occasional offset-like detailing, giving the letters a slightly dimensional, shadowed feel without becoming heavy. Proportions are compact in the lowercase with uneven, humanized widths and irregular counters that reinforce an organic, improvised look.

This font works best for short-to-medium display settings where its texture and inner detailing can read clearly—posters, headlines, cover art, packaging, and branding for playful or artisanal products. It can also add personality to pull quotes or section titles in editorial layouts, especially when paired with a calmer text face.

The overall tone is playful and mischievous, with a spontaneous handwritten energy that feels informal and characterful. Its sharp flicks and looping curves suggest motion and personality, leaning toward whimsical, storybook, or indie aesthetics rather than corporate neutrality.

The design appears intended to capture a brisk brush-script feel in a semi-structured alphabet, balancing readability with expressive quirks. The internal cut/offset detailing adds a decorative edge that helps the letterforms stand out in display contexts while preserving a lightweight, airy color on the page.

The capitals are more emblematic and gestural than geometric, with simplified forms that emphasize silhouette and diagonal momentum. Numerals keep the same brush rhythm, with open curves and pointed joins that maintain consistency with the alphabet. The font’s visual interest comes from the combination of tapered strokes, occasional interior separation, and the lively irregularity of hand lettering.
